Somerset Estates is an established Niwot subdivision with custom homes. Public HOA material describes 89 custom homes on a hill near open space and trails.
Ask for covenants, architectural standards, budget, reserves, meeting minutes, and current project updates. Somerset HOA documents include water, pond, drainage, and entrance materials that buyers should review.
Compare custom build quality, remodel permits, roof age, basement finish, lot slope, mature landscaping, and open-space adjacency. Custom homes can differ widely even within the same subdivision.
Somerset HOA posts documents about water, ponds, and drainage. Buyers should ask how these issues affect the exact property, dues, common areas, and any future assessments.
Highway 52, Niwot Road, 79th Street, Boulder, and Longmont routes are important. A listing's position within Somerset can change drive patterns and views.
Review drainage, retaining walls, irrigation, mature trees, foundation, radon mitigation, roof condition, and any basement moisture. Boulder County clay and slope can make drainage important.
Use the exact address with the district. Do not rely on the Somerset name or nearby Niwot landmarks for boundary confirmation.
